1. Wood Screws

Wood screws are among the many most commonly used fasteners in construction. They function a sharp point and coarse threads designed to bite into wood fibers, providing strong holding energy without splitting the material. These screws usually have a smooth shank near the head, allowing the top board to tug tightly in opposition to the underside piece.

Common uses:

Furniture assembly

Framing and carpentry

Wooden deck building

Cabinet set up

For outdoor projects, it’s finest to make use of galvanized or stainless steel wood screws to forestall rust and corrosion from moisture exposure.

2. Drywall Screws

Drywall screws are specifically designed for attaching drywall sheets to wood or metal studs. They function fine or coarse threads depending on the material they’re securing. Coarse-thread drywall screws work best with wood studs, while fine-thread screws are ideal for metal studs.

Their bugle-formed head permits them to sink neatly into drywall without tearing the paper surface. Most are black phosphate-coated to resist corrosion and enhance paint adhesion.

Common uses:

Installing drywall panels

Ceiling installations

Securing lightweight fixtures

3. Deck Screws

Deck screws are constructed for outdoor durability. Made from coated steel or stainless metal, they resist corrosion caused by moisture and temperature changes. They usually have deep, sharp threads for additional grip and a countersinking head for a clean finish.

Common uses:

Decking boards

Fences

Outdoor wooden constructions

Using self-drilling deck screws can save time and reduce the risk of wood splitting, particularly in hardwood decking.

4. Sheet Metal Screws

Sheet metal screws are designed for fastening thin metal sheets to other supplies, including metal, plastic, or wood. They come with sharp, self-tapping points that can pierce metal surfaces without pre-drilling. Some even have hex heads for better torque application.

Common makes use of:

HVAC systems

Metal roofing

Automotive applications

Electrical enclosures

Stainless metal sheet metal screws are preferred for outside or high-humidity environments attributable to their corrosion resistance.

5. Concrete Screws

Concrete screws, additionally known as masonry screws, are engineered to anchor materials directly into concrete, brick, or block. They feature hardened steel building with particular high-low threads that dig into masonry surfaces for superior holding power.

Common makes use of:

Securing frames to concrete walls

Mounting fixtures or electrical boxes

Attaching furring strips or shelves

For the perfect outcomes, pre-drill a pilot hole utilizing a masonry bit earlier than inserting the screw.

6. Lag Screws

Lag screws, typically called lag bolts, are heavy-duty fasteners designed for high-stress structural applications. They’ve thick shafts and coarse threads, making them ideally suited for joining heavy timbers and other dense materials. Lag screws typically require a wrench or socket for installation.

Common uses:

Wooden beams and posts

Deck helps

Structural framing

Heavy machinery anchoring

When energy and stability are top priorities, lag screws are the go-to option.

7. Self-Tapping and Self-Drilling Screws

Self-tapping screws form their own threads as they are pushed into materials, eliminating the necessity for pre-drilling. Self-drilling screws, alternatively, come with a constructed-in drill bit tip that cuts through metal or wood with ease.

Common makes use of:

Metal roofing

Light-gauge metal framing

HVAC and ductwork

These screws are glorious for speeding up set up while maintaining robust, secure joints.
